TTE is a leading developer and innovator in the exciting and expanding fields of Advanced Driver Assist System (ADAS) and Automated Driving (AD). These rapidly evolving sensors, cameras and lidar-based technologies assist drivers by providing information and acting on environment data at the front, side, and rear of vehicles to help warn drivers of impending danger.
Job Summary:
The Facility Coordinator will oversee the maintenance and repairs of electrical, plumbing, heating, ventilation, air conditioning (HVAC), carpentry, painting, and all building systems.
Duties/Responsibilities:
· Oversees the day-to-day operations to maintain the building.
· Evaluates systems or facilities to determine maintenance or repairs that need to be performed.
· Assesses building systems to plan work assignments and project schedules.
· Ensures maintenance and repair work is completed correctly and in a timely manner.
· Assists with departmental budget estimates and costs of specific repair projects.
· Schedules and organizes work projects with contractors.
· Set up new credentials for existing key card access and configure system settings.
· Implement new alarm system and establish security service.
· Knowledge of building codes/permit requirements for managing application submissions.
· Schedule and oversee all building inspections.
· Monitor and conduct filter replacements for furnace systems.
· Create/update contractor’s list for ongoing and future projects, while maintaining a strong relationship as the “point of contact”.
· Performs other related duties as assigned.
